    Solution: apply patch 113614-12 to bring SunVTS 5.1 up to 5.1p2 level.

    My thanks to Casper *** and "AP'.

    Interesingly, the SunVTS 5.1 that I installed was just recently pulled
    down from Sun's download center, and there is no indication of the
    patch.

    >I am running SunVTS 5.1 on a Sunfire 280R. The physical memory test
    >(pmemtest) is failing with error code 8004. The error message is
    >"Unable to read pointer to memlist structure.". This seems odd since
    >I'm running as root. I'm using the GUI and mainly going with the
    >defaults.
    >
    >The system is Solaris 2.8 with kernel patch level 108528-20. I don't
    >seem to be able to find any useful information about this in the
    >manuals. If anyone knows what the causes of this might be or where it
    >might be documented, I'd appreciate it. Thanks.
